I try to compile elfutils on OpenWrt with the newest gcc 12.2.0 version. However, it fails due to -Werror=use-after-free. A workaround is a patch that I found on the mailinglist, to disable -Werror (https://sourceware.org/legacy-ml/elfutils-devel/imported/msg00994.html) I modified it to apply to newest elfutils version. The error with elfutils 0.187 and gcc 12.2.0:

In function 'bigger_buffer',
    inlined from '__libdw_gunzip' at gzip.c:376:12:
gzip.c:98:9: error: pointer may be used after 'realloc' [-Werror=use-after-free]
   98 |     b = realloc (state->buffer, more -= 1024);
      |         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
gzip.c:96:13: note: call to 'realloc' here
   96 |   char *b = realloc (state->buffer, more);
      |             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~

cc1: all warnings being treated as errors

Can you apply the patch to disable werror? Or is it necessary to use some "#pragma GCC diagnostic push
#pragma GCC diagnostic ignored "-Wuse-after-free""-statement?
